The United States boasts an impressive coastline with numerous beautiful beaches. According to the Environmental Protection Agency's (EPA) BEACH Act list, there are over 1,500 beaches in the United States ¹. Here's a breakdown of the top 10 states with the most beaches: - *Washington*: 1,228 beaches, with Alki Beach in Seattle being a popular spot ² - *Michigan*: 598 beaches, featuring Cheboygan State Park Beach in Cheboygan ²
- *Massachusetts*: 576 beaches, including Crane Beach in Ipswich ² - *Florida*: 575 beaches, with Destin Beach in Destin being a favorite among tourists ² - *New Jersey*: 454 beaches, boasting Cape May Beach in Cape May ² - *Hawaii*: 406 beaches, featuring Kaanapali Beach in Maui ² - *New York*: 354 beaches, including Jacob Riis Beach in Jacob Riis Park ² - *California*: 252 beaches, with Pfeiffer Beach in Big Sur being a stunning spot ² - *North Carolina*: 216 beaches, featuring Emerald Isle Beach in Emerald Isle ² - *Alaska*: 208 beaches, including Black Sand Beach in Prince William Sound ² These numbers are based on the EPA's BEACH Act list, which includes coastal and Great Lakes beaches only ¹. Other sources may have different counts or definitions of what constitutes a beach.
